Output 2532846306ac6c4c42a74e8cf76e96bd47f4e378cf6dfa94aaead95e61ba1a32:0

value
8788413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 233c240b179b640f539b01c735d7e7806057705f OP_EQUAL
address
34uKcuw8fZSNRGgJufkkTeVw3LeA3uWCkU
transaction
2532846306ac6c4c42a74e8cf76e96bd47f4e378cf6dfa94aaead95e61ba1a32
confirmations
375483
spent
true